Output f266d4456031688d69a931e495e9aa4475c3b6bc931448740ab4760e7aad4c6d:27

value
39551
script pubkey
OP_0 OP_PUSHBYTES_20 5423842bdd11f592382dac801e5821adbc7107e0
address
bc1q2s3cg27az86eywpd4jqpukpp4k78zplq98x6qd
transaction
f266d4456031688d69a931e495e9aa4475c3b6bc931448740ab4760e7aad4c6d